What's The Definition Of Shovelful?

[n] the quantity a shovel can hold

Synonyms | Synonyms for Shovelful: shovel | spadeful

Shovelful In Webster's Dictionary

\Shov"el*ful\, n.; pl. {Shovelfuls}. As much as a shovel will hold; enough to fill a shovel.
